Longtime CT lurker here with an extensive security background. Going to start trying something a little different and will be sharing crypto security insights.
First topic: incident response 👇
Incident response has a few layers: preparation, detection, analysis, mitigation, comms, and recovery. All should be documented and tested prior to an incident. If you expect the unexpected, you’ll be better prepared for the next threat and may prevent a multi-million dollar loss
